OBJECTIVES: To assess the myocardium-reperfusing effect of a distal protection device, GuardWire Plus (GuardWire Plus), in patients with acute myocardial infarction (AMI). BACKGROUND: Distal embolization may result in reduced myocardial perfusion, increasing the risk of non-Q-wave myocardial infarction and death. Distal protection devices may protect the microcirculation from embolic debris, improving short- and long-term clinical outcomes. METHODS: From February 2002 to July 2003, a total of 341 AMI patients at 22 institutions in Japan were enrolled in the present, multicenter, prospective, randomized trial. Patients experiencing AMI within 12 hr of symptom onset, who were considered treatable by stenting and who met the inclusion criteria, were eligible for randomization. Stenting with and without GuardWire Plus was conducted to examine whether the device provides faster and more complete ST-segment resolution, smaller infarct size, and improved myocardial blush score. RESULTS: The rates of slow flow and no-reflow immediately after PCI were 5.3 and 11.4% in the GuardWire Plus and control groups, respectively (P = 0.05). Blush score 3 acquisition rates immediately after PCI were 25.2 and 20.3% in the GuardWire Plus and control groups, respectively (P = 0.26), and the rates at 30 days after PCI were 42.9 and 30.4%, respectively (P = 0.035). CONCLUSIONS: A significant difference was found between the GuardWire Plus and control groups with respect to the total incidence of distal embolization, indicating that GuardWire Plus angiographically improved myocardial perfusion without demonstrating the preventive effect of myocardial damage.  相似文献

Opinion statement The success of intervention and clinical outcome is markedly reduced in patients who sustain distal embolization during percutaneous coronary intervention (PCI). Such embolization occurs in up to 15% of patients with acute myocardial infarction (AMI) undergoing PCI, and angiographic indicators of embolization are highly predictive of clinical and functional outcome. Saphenous vein graft (SVG) interventions carry a 20% risk of major adverse cardiac events (MACE), predominantly AMI, and significant risk of no-reflow. There are four types of embolic protection: distal occlusion/aspiration systems, filters, proximal occlusion/aspiration devices, and thrombectomy catheters. There seem to be no data to suggest that routine use of any embolic protection system is beneficial in patients with ST-elevation myocardial infarction (STEMI) undergoing PCI. The message from both the EMERALD and PROMISE trials is that embolic protection does not improve perfusion in the setting of AMI. Although pretreatment with thrombus aspiration before PCI improves angiographic reperfusion rates compared with standard PCI, enzymatic release and early clinical outcomes are not improved. Although the clinical implications of routine thrombus aspiration have yet to be established, selective use may be justified in patients with the highest thrombus burden. In addition, it should be considered in those with acute stent thrombosis and elective use of filter-based protection considered in very high risk vessel PCI (eg, last remaining conduit). There is no easy way to anticipate which SVG intervention will result in embolization. In SVG intervention, both balloon occlusion/aspiration and filter-based distal protection devices have significantly reduced the incidence of 30-day MACE, driven by AMI and should, I believe, be used routinely. Risk of complications is low with all the established devices. The profile and deliverability are continuing to improve with newer devices. Cost-effectiveness of selective use in high-risk graft cases has only recently been demonstrated.  相似文献

OBJECTIVES: We sought to evaluate the effects of mechanical thrombectomy on myocardial reperfusion during direct angioplasty for acute myocardial infarction (AMI). BACKGROUND: Embolization of thrombus and plaque debris may occur during direct angioplasty for AMI. This may lead to distal vessel or side branch occlusion and to obstructions in the microvascular system, resulting in impaired myocardial reperfusion. Mechanical thrombectomy is used to reduce distal embolization. METHODS: Ninety-two patients with AMI and angiographic evidence of intraluminal thrombus were randomized to either intracoronary thrombectomy followed by stenting or to a conventional strategy of stenting. Thrombectomy was performed using the X-Sizer catheter (EndiCOR Inc., San Clemente, California). Myocardial reperfusion was assessed by myocardial blush and ST resolution. RESULTS: Postprocedure Thrombolysis in Myocardial Infarction-3 flow was not different between groups (93.5% vs. 95.7%, p = 0.39). Myocardial blush-3 was observed in 71.7% of patients undergoing thrombectomy and in 36.9% of patients undergoing conventional strategy (p = 0.006). ST-segment resolution >or=50% occurred more often in patients undergoing thrombectomy (82.6% vs. 52.2%, p = 0.001). By multivariate analysis, adjunctive thrombectomy was an independent predictor of blush-3 (odds ratio, 3.27; 95% confidence interval, 1.06 to 10.05; p = 0.039). CONCLUSIONS: Intracoronary thrombectomy as adjunct to stenting during direct angioplasty for AMI improves myocardial reperfusion as assessed by myocardial blush and ST resolution.  相似文献

血栓抽吸导管在急性心肌梗死患者治疗中的临床应用   总被引:2,自引:0,他引:2  
目的评估ZEEK血栓抽吸导管在急性心肌梗死患者治疗中的临床应用。方法将316例行急诊介入治疗的急性心肌梗死患者分为两组,其中使用ZEEK血栓抽吸导管127例患者作为ZEEK组,未使用ZEEK血栓抽吸导管189例患者作为对照组。观察无复流发生率、术后ST段下降率、住院病死率及左心室射血分数等。结果ZEEK组4例发生无复流,发生率为3.1%,住院期间无死亡。对照组189例中有18例发生无复流,发生率9.5%,死亡6例(3.2%)。两组患者的无复流发生率、ST段下降率、住院病死率及心功能均具有显著差异(P<0.05)。结论急性心肌梗死在急诊介入治疗中,应用ZEEK血栓抽吸导管可以降低无复流发生率和住院病死率。  相似文献

Background

Optimizing microcirculation in STEMI patients with thrombus-containing lesion undergoing percutaneous coronary intervention (PCI) remains challenging. Our objective was to compare the effects on myocardial perfusion and cardiac function of delayed vs immediate stent implantation after thrombus aspiration in STEMI patients undergoing PCI.

Methods

Eighty-seven STEMI patients with thrombus-containing lesion undergoing PCI were enrolled. After thrombus aspiration was performed, subjects were divided into 2 groups according to residual thrombus score (TS): immediate stent implantation (ISI) group (n = 47, residual TS < 2; stenting was performed immediately), and delayed stent implantation (DSI) group (n = 40, residual TS ≥ 2; stenting was performed 7 days later). Corrected thrombolysis in myocardial infarction frame count and myocardial blush grade were analyzed immediately after PCI. The wall motion score index was assessed on admission and at 6-month follow-up.

Results

At the end of the PCI procedure, the corrected thrombolysis in myocardial infarction frame count was significantly shorter and the myocardial blush grade 3 was more frequent in the DSI group than in the ISI group. Compared with the ISI group, the DSI group had a lower incidence of thrombus-related angiographic events, including distal embolization and no reflow. A significantly greater improvement in wall motion score index from baseline to 6-month follow-up was observed in the DSI group compared with the ISI group.

Conclusions

In STEMI patients presenting with thrombus containing lesion undergoing PCI, delayed stent implantation after thrombus aspiration leads to better myocardial perfusion and cardiac functional recovery in comparison with immediate stent implantation.  相似文献

BACKGROUND: The angiographic no-reflow phenomenon is an adverse prognostic factor in patients with acute myocardial infarction (AMI). The aim of the present study was to evaluate the effects of an occlusive balloon type distal protection device (PercuSurge GuardWire: GW) during primary stenting in patients with anterior AMI. METHODS AND RESULTS: The GW group included 42 patients treated by primary stenting with GW protection and the control group included 30 patients treated by primary stenting after thrombectomy without distal protection. Left ventricular (LV) function was measured and compared by left ventriculography obtained soon after percutaneous coronary intervention (PCI) and 3 weeks after onset. The corrected TIMI frame count values were lower in the GW group than in the control group (27.5+/-2.3 vs 35.1 +/-2.5, p=0.030). The number of patients with myocardial blush grade 3 after PCI was higher in the GW group than in the control group (45.7 vs 20.0%, p=0.029). Peak concentration of creatine kinase myocardial fraction was lower in the GW group than in the control group (326.6+/-41.5 vs 454.9+/-46.2 mg/dl, p=0.043). GW patients showed greater improvement at 3 weeks after PCI in terms of LV ejection fraction (+4.6+/-1.2 vs -1.1+/-1.5, p=0.004), LV end-systolic volume index (+0.5+/-2.4 vs +9.0+/-2.7, p=0.023), and regional wall motion abnormalities (-2.03+/-0.14 vs -2.51+/-0.14, p=0.018). CONCLUSION: Primary stenting with GW protection can restore epicardial coronary flow and myocardial perfusion, and also preserve LV function in anterior AMI.  相似文献

目的 探讨急性ST段抬高心肌梗死急诊经皮冠状动脉介入治疗(PCI)中联合应用ZEEK血栓抽吸导管和替罗非班对心肌组织灌注及临床预后的影响.方法 84例经冠脉造影证实为血栓负荷病变的急性ST段抬高心肌梗死患者随机分为血栓抽吸+替罗非班42例(A组)和标准PCI 42例(B组),比较两组患者手术后即刻梗死相关动脉(IRA)的心肌梗死溶栓(TIMI)血流、心肌灌注分级(MBG)、心电图ST段回落百分比、左心室射血分数(LVEF)及住院期间主要心脏不良事件(MACE)和出血性并发症发生率.结果 A组术后即刻TIMI血流、MBG、ST段抬高回落百分比及LVEF均明显优于B组(P〈0.05),两组住院期间的MACE发生率及出血并发症比较差异无统计学意义(P〉0.05).结论 在急性心肌梗死急诊PCI中联合使用ZEEK导管血栓抽吸和替罗非班安全可行,可有效清除冠状动脉内血栓,改善心肌组织灌注和术后心脏功能,并且不增加主要心脏不良事件的发生率.  相似文献

急性心肌梗死直接介入治疗中Diver CE血栓抽吸术的应用   总被引:2,自引:0,他引:2  
目的探讨和评价急性心肌梗死(AMI)急诊冠状动脉介入治疗(PCI)中联合应用Div-erCE血栓抽吸术的疗效及安全性。方法选择符合急诊PCI的AMI并经冠状动脉造影明确梗死相关冠状动脉(IRA)内高负荷血栓性病变的56例患者,随机分为两组,Diver CE组(n=28)用DiverCE血栓抽吸导管抽吸血栓后再行PCI治疗,对照组(n=28)直接行PCI治疗。结果Diver CE血栓抽吸术后的PCI术后ST段回落(STR)(〉70%)明显优于对照组(71.4%比39.3%,P〈0.05) 术后冠状动脉TIMI血流(2.8±0.4比2.0±0.6,P〈0.05)、血栓积分(TS)(0.1±0.2比1.5±1.0,P〈0.05)、左室舒张末期容积(left ventricular end-diastolic volume,LVEDV)(50±12mL比60±14mL,P〈0.05)、左室射血分数(LVEF)(0.58±0.18比0.46±0.14,P〈0.05)较对照组明显改善,慢血流/无复流发生率低(3.6%比14.3%,P〈0.05) 30d时主要不良心脏事件(MACE)包括死亡、心肌梗死和靶血管再成形术和缺血性卒中的发生率两组未见明显差异(0比3.6%,P〉0.05)。未见与Diver CE血栓抽吸相关的血管并发症。结论Diver CE血栓抽吸术能促进AMI急诊PCI术后STR,改善TIMI血流、TS和左心室功能 该方法操作简单,安全性高 对AMI患者,若其冠状动脉内以血栓性病变为主,应考虑应用Diver CE血栓抽吸术。  相似文献

AMI (Acute Myocardial Infarction) is usually caused by abrupt plague rupture followed by thrombus formation inside the coronary artery. Primary angioplasty for heavy thrombus loaded vessels may be complicated by distal embolization, leading to no reflow and myocardial damage. We present a case of acute thrombotic occlusion of the left anterior descending artery (LAD), in which we performed simultaneous thrombus removal by the rescue aspiration thrombectomy catheter together with an EPI FilterWire for distal protection against embolization. The lesion was successfully stented with excellent perfusion to the distal capillaries. A huge load of debris (red and white) was retrieved by both devices. The patient remained asymptomatic at 9 months. This case illustrates the possible DUAL protective roles of Aspiration Thrombectomy and Filtering devices in high risk angioplasty for AMI patients.  相似文献

OBJECTIVES: We sought to compare, in a prospective randomized multicenter study, the effect of adjunctive thrombectomy using X-Sizer (eV3, White Bear Lake, Minnesota) before percutaneous coronary intervention (PCI) versus conventional PCI in patients with acute myocardial infarction (AMI) for <12 h and Thrombolysis In Myocardial Infarction (TIMI) flow grade 0 to 1. The primary end point was the magnitude of ST-segment resolution after PCI. BACKGROUND: Despite a high rate of TIMI flow grade 3 achieved by PCI in patients with AMI, myocardial reperfusion remains relatively low. Distal embolization of thrombotic materials may play a major role in this setting. METHODS: We conducted a prospective, randomized, multicenter study in patients with AMI <12 h and initial TIMI flow grade 0 to 1 who were treated with primary PCI. The magnitude of ST-segment resolution 1 h after PCI was the primary end point. RESULTS: A total of 201 patients were included. Treatment groups were comparable by age (61 +/- 13 years), diabetes (22%), previous MI (8%), anterior MI (52%), onset-to-angiogram (258 +/- 173 min), and glycoprotein IIb/IIIa inhibitor use (59%). The magnitude of ST-segment resolution was greater in the X-Sizer group compared with the conventional group (7.5 vs. 4.9 mm, respectively; p = 0.033) as ST-segment resolution >50% (68% vs. 53%; p = 0.037). The occurrence of distal embolization was reduced (2% vs. 10%; p = 0.033) and TIMI flow grade 3 was obtained in 96% vs. 89%, respectively (p = 0.105). Myocardial blush grade 3 was similar (30% vs. 31%; p = NS). Six-month clinical outcome was comparable (death, 6% vs. 4% and major adverse cardiac and cerebral events, 13% vs. 13%, respectively). By multivariate analysis, independent predictors of ST-segment resolution >50% were: younger age, non-anterior MI, use of the X-Sizer, and a short time interval from symptom onset. CONCLUSIONS: Reducing thrombus burden with X-Sizer before stenting leads to better myocardial reperfusion, as illustrated by a reduced risk of distal embolization and better ST-segment resolution.  相似文献

Primary percutaneous coronary intervention (PCI) for ST-segment elevation myocardial infarction (STEMI) achieves a high epicardial reperfusion rate; however, it is often suboptimal in achieving myocardial reperfusion due to distal embolization of atherothrombotic particles. The present study assessed whether the capture of embolic particles during PCI would improve myocardial reperfusion outcome. In a multicenter, prospective, randomized, controlled study, 100 patients with STEMI and coronary angiographic evidence of thrombotic occlusion were randomly assigned to PCI using the FilterWire EZ (n=51) or a control group (n=49) using regular guidewires. The FilterWire EZ was successfully delivered across the lesion in 84% of patients in the FilterWire EZ group. Primary efficacy end points, including markers of epicardial (Thrombolysis In Myocardial Infarction grade flow) and myocardial reperfusion (myocardial blush score and percent early resolution of ST-segment elevation), did not differ between the 2 study groups. Further, 60- and 90-minute percent ST-segment resolutions were identical in the 2 groups. In a subgroup analysis, a blush score of 3 was achieved in 94% of patients in whom the filter's landing zone was in a vessel diameter>2.5 mm compared with only 55% in those with smaller vessel diameter (p=0.04). This corresponds to a better debris capture in filters located in large versus small vessels (p=0.08). In conclusion, in patients with STEMI, use of the FilterWire EZ as an adjunct to primary PCI did not improve angiographic or electrocardiographic measurements of reperfusion compared with conventional PCI only.  相似文献

目的:分析在急性ST段抬高型心肌梗死(STEMI)急诊行经皮冠状动脉介入治疗(PCI)中应用抽吸导管对心肌再灌注影响.方法:首次STEMI行PCI患者80例,随机分为试验组(41例,应用抽吸导管后再行PCI),对照组(39例,直接行PCI).比较2组术后即刻计算校正TIMI计帧数和心肌Blush分级、术中慢复流现象、心电图90 min ST段下降率.在术后24 h、1周时应用心肌声学造影计算灌注对比积分指数(CSI)、室壁运动积分指数(WMSI).结果:PCI后试验组的校正TIMI计帧数明显低于对照组,Blush分级≥2级获得率高于对照组,慢复流现象减少;再通后90 min心电图相关导联ST段下降率试验组明显大于对照组(P<0.05).同时在研究的每一个时点,试验组CSI、WMSI较对照组明显降低(P<0.05).结论:在STEMI急诊行PCI中应用抽吸导管可改善梗死相关血管前向血流情况,改善心肌再灌注,减少无复流现象.  相似文献

目的评价急性心肌梗死(AMI)患者经皮冠状动脉介入治疗(PCI)中应用Diver CE血栓抽吸导管的可靠性、实用性与安全性。方法选择我院2006年7月至2007年7月接受直接PCI的AMI患者64例,分成血栓抽吸后经皮冠状动脉介入治疗组(PT+PCI)与单纯PCI组,比较两组间TIMI血流、心肌灌注分级(TMP)(2.65±0.54)级、2 h ST段回落率56.07%±9.20%、左室射血分数(LVEF)及血管重建率。结果PT+PCI组的TIMI血流(2.54±0.18)级、TMP(2.65±0.54)级、2 h ST段回落率89.73%±9.43%、LVEF值56.07%±9.20%及血管重建率0%,明显优于单纯PCI组的TIMI血流(2.01±0.28)级、TMP(1.52±0.47)级、2 hST段回落率56.41%±12.59%、LVEF值51.11%±8.97%及血管重建率3.33%(P<0.05)。结论PCI中应用Diver CE血栓抽吸装置能明显减少冠状动脉血栓及远端栓塞,有效地改善心肌灌注,减少无复流发生,使用安全,效果明显。  相似文献

目的:评估血栓抽吸装置在急性心肌梗塞(AMI)急诊冠状动脉介入治疗(PCI)患者治疗中的临床应用。方法:86例行急诊PCI治疗的AMI患者被随机分为血栓抽吸组(41例,应用抽吸导管后再行PCI),直接PCI组(45例,直接行PCI),观察无复流发生率、术后ST段下降率及左心室射血分数等。结果:PCI后血栓抽吸组患者的无复流发生率明显低于直接PCI组(4.9%∶11.1%,P0.05),ST段回落率(66.67%、75.61%)、LVEF[(54.02±8.93)%∶(49.23±9.12)%]均优于直接PCI组(P均0.05)。结论:急诊冠脉介入治疗急性心肌梗塞患者时,应用血栓抽吸导管可以降低无复流发生率,改善心功能,且安全有效。  相似文献

目的对急性ST段抬高性心肌梗死患者行急诊冠状动脉介入(percutaneous coronary intervention,PCI)治疗,经冠状动脉内血栓抽吸后使心肌梗死溶栓试验(TIMI)血流达3级后,比较延期支架植入与即刻支架植入两种治疗方式对预后的影响。方法选择2010年1月至2012年1月符合急诊PCI治疗条件的急性心肌梗患者共149例.经冠状动脉内血栓抽吸后使心肌梗死溶栓试验血流达2~3级后,93例当时植入支架患者为即刻支架植入组.56例术后经强化抗凝及抗血小板治疗5~7d后再次手术植入支架者为延迟支架植入组,观察两组ST段术后回落超过50%的患者例数、慢血流或无复流发生率、心肌染色分级及支架使用情况,同时随访术后3个月时心功能状态及主要心血管事件(包括心肌梗死、血运重建、卒中、各种原因的死亡)。结果延期支架组心电图ST段回落比例明显高于即刻支架植入组,差异有统计学意义(62%vs.46%,P〈0.01)。无复流及慢血流在延迟支架组明显少于即刻支架组,差异有统计学意义(8%vs.17%,P〈0.01)。延迟支架组支架使用量明显少于即刻支架组,差异有统计学了意义[(2.3±0.7)枚 vs.(3.5±1.1)枚,P〈0.01]。3个月后两组主要心血管事件及左心室功能状态比较,差异无统计学意义(P〉0.05)。结论冠状动脉内血栓抽吸后延迟支架植入,可减少支架使用量,有利于减少无复流及慢血流现象的发生,对近期预后无不利影响。  相似文献

The aim of this study was to investigate the relation between lesion morphology identified by intravascular ultrasound (IVUS) before intervention and angiographic distal embolization after percutaneous coronary intervention (PCI) in patients with acute myocardial infarction (AMI). PCI for AMI has already been established as beneficial therapy, although some complications remain unresolved. Distal embolization is 1 of the important complications of PCI. Recently, some new devices have been developed for the prevention of distal embolization. However, few studies exist that look into the relation between lesion morphology and distal embolization. IVUS was performed safely in 140 consecutive patients with AMI before coronary intervention. No patient received thrombolytic therapy. From the incidence of angiographic distal embolization, patients were divided into 2 groups--an embolization group and a nonembolization group--and clinical background, IVUS, and angiographic information were evaluated. Distal embolization was observed in 12 patients (9%). Peak creatine kinase levels (3,877 +/- 2,285 vs 2,293 +/- 1,792 IU/L, p <0.05) and the incidence of angiographic thrombus (25% vs 5%, p <0.05) and intracoronary mobile mass detected by IVUS (75% vs 16%, p <0.001) were higher for patients in the embolization group. From the multivariate logistic regression analysis, only an intracoronary mobile mass detected by IVUS emerged as a predictor of distal embolization (odds ratio 53, 95% confidence interval 2.7 to 1,040, p <0.01). Patients with an intracoronary mobile mass detected by IVUS are prone to distal embolization after PCI and larger infarction. IVUS imaging before PCI may be useful for determining which patients need a distal protection device.  相似文献

目的分析在血栓负荷较大的急性心肌梗死(AMI)患者行急诊PCI中,应用抽吸导管对心肌再灌注的影响及安全性。方法选择经急诊冠状动脉造影显示血栓负荷较大的AMI患者36例作为血栓抽吸组,另选同期采用常规PCI的AMI患者36例作为对照组,比较2组的血栓负荷、TIMI分级、TIMI心肌灌注(TMP)分级、心肌酶峰值、ST段回落幅度、LVEF、住院期间心血管不良事件。结果血栓抽吸组患者经抽吸后血栓负荷明显降低;血栓抽吸组患者TIMI分级和TMP分级明显优于对照组,差异有统计学意义(P0.01);血栓抽吸组患者较对照组肌酸激酶、肌酸激酶同工酶峰值明显降低,术后1 h ST段回落百分比明显增高,LVEF明显升高,左心室舒张末内径明显下降,差异有统计学意义(P0.01)。结论在血栓负荷较重的AMI患者行急诊PCI时,应用血栓抽吸导管安全可行,可显著改善梗死相关血管前向血流情况,改善心肌再灌注,减少无复流现象和心肌酶的释放。  相似文献

Current treatment for coronary stent thrombosis (ST) often lacks satisfactory results and clinical outcome is poor. We investigated the impact of manual thrombus aspiration during percutaneous coronary intervention (PCI) on myocardial reperfusion and clinical outcome in patients with angiographically proved ST. We interrogated our PCI registry for patients with a first stent placement from January 2002 through May 2010 who had undergone an emergency repeated PCI procedure and systematically reviewed coronary angiograms and hospital records for evidence of ST. We identified 113 patients with ST. Thrombus aspiration was used in 51 patients and 62 patients received conventional PCI. Histopathologic analysis of thrombus aspirates was performed in 6 patients. Use of thrombus aspiration predicted postprocedure Thrombolysis In Myocardial Infarction grade 3 flow (odds ratio 3.16, 95% confidence interval 1.22 to 8.17, p = 0.018) and myocardial blush grade 2/3 (odds ratio 3.20, 95% confidence interval 1.20 to 8.55, p = 0.020) after multivariable adjustment with bootstrap model selection. Distal embolization was lower in the thrombus aspiration group compared to the conventional PCI group (14% vs 37%, p = 0.017). In most patients, aspirated thrombus was large and contained platelet and erythrocyte components at histopathologic analysis. Mortality in the thrombus aspiration group and conventional PCI group was 9.8% versus 16% at 30 days (p = 0.351) and 12% versus 21% at 1 year (p = 0.220), respectively. In conclusion, use of manual thrombus aspiration in patients with ST was associated with greater epicardial and microvascular myocardial reperfusion. In addition, mortality was lower in patients treated with thrombus aspiration, although not statistically significant.  相似文献

OBJECTIVES: We sought to determine the prognostic importance of myocardial reperfusion after various contemporary interventional strategies in patients with acute myocardial infarction (AMI). BACKGROUND: The frequency, correlates, and clinical implications of myocardial perfusion after primary angioplasty in AMI have not been examined in a large-scale prospective study. Similarly, whether glycoprotein (GP) IIb/IIIa inhibitors and/or stents improve myocardial perfusion beyond balloon angioplasty has not been investigated. METHODS: Tissue-level perfusion assessed by the myocardial blush grade was evaluated in 1,301 patients with AMI randomized to balloon angioplasty versus stenting, each with or without abciximab. RESULTS: Despite Thrombolysis In Myocardial Infarction flow grade 3 restoration in 96.1% of patients, myocardial perfusion was normal in only 17.4% of patients, reduced in 33.9%, and absent in 48.7%. Myocardial perfusion status post-coronary intervention stratified patients into three distinct risk categories, with 1-year mortality rates of 1.4% (normal blush), 4.1% (reduced blush), and 6.2% (absent blush) (p = 0.01). Among patients randomized to angioplasty, angioplasty + abciximab, stenting, and stenting + abciximab, normal myocardial perfusion was restored in 17.7%, 17.0%, 17.5%, and 17.6%, respectively (p = 0.95), which was associated with similar 1-year rates of mortality in patients randomized to stenting versus angioplasty (4.5% vs. 4.8%, p = 0.91) and abciximab versus no abciximab (4.3% vs. 5.0%, p = 0.63). CONCLUSIONS: Restoration of normal tissue-level perfusion is a powerful determinate of survival after primary PCI in AMI and is achieved in a minority of patients. Neither stents nor GP IIb/IIIa inhibitors significantly enhance myocardial perfusion compared to balloon angioplasty alone, underlying the similar long-term mortality with these different mechanical reperfusion strategies.  相似文献

BackgroundMany studies have reported that low final thrombolysis in myocardial infarction (TIMI) flow and/or myocardial blush grade (MBG) are independent predictors of mortality in patients with ST-elevation myocardial infarction (STEMI). In addition, distal coronary embolization is a major pitfall of conventional percutaneous coronary intervention (PCI) in such a context.AimThis study aimed to assess the impact of thrombus aspiration (TA) use before primary PCI on final myocardial reperfusion in patients presenting with STEMI.MethodsFrom January to December 2006, 100 patients presenting with STEMI in our catheterization laboratory were considered for the present study. During this time period, 50 patients underwent TA before primary PCI for treatment of STEMI and were then matched 1:1 to 50 controls who underwent conventional primary PCI for treatment of STEMI without TA. Patients of the control group were chosen after matching on age±3 years, sex, history of diabetes, and distribution of the infarct related coronary artery during the same period.ResultsBaseline clinical characteristics, initial TIMI flow and initial MBG of both groups were similar. There was a trend for a better final TIMI flow in the group with TA and the final MBG was significantly improved in the group with TA compared to the group without TA: final MBG of two or three in 70% versus 30% of the cases (P=.001). In addition, direct stenting was significantly more often used in the TA group (92% versus 64%, P=.001). There were four patients with evident distal embolizations in the group without TA and none in the group with TA.ConclusionTA use before primary PCI for STEMI treatment resulted in improved final myocardial reperfusion. Of importance, TA use may have led to a better choice of the stent size and more frequent direct stenting. This benefit may directly improve patient outcomes.  相似文献
